Car showrooms face a unique challenge: they must present vehicles in the most compelling light while managing a highly competitive, fast-paced retail environment. Traditional signage and static displays cannot match the dynamic allure of modern digital screens. For premium automotive retailers, the GOB LED display (Glue On Board) has emerged as the definitive visual solution. This advanced technology encapsulates the LED surface with a durable, transparent optical glue, resulting in a display that is both visually stunning and exceptionally resilient. Unlike standard indoor LED panels, GOB technology is engineered to withstand the specific physical demands of a showroom floor, including accidental bumps from cleaning equipment, customer contact, and the inevitable dust and moisture that accompany a high-traffic retail space. For a car showroom, where every detail of a vehicle’s finish must be seen with absolute clarity, the GOB LED display provides a seamless, high-impact canvas that elevates the entire customer experience.
The primary function of any showroom display is to showcase the vehicle’s design, from the curvature of the body panels to the intricate stitching of the interior. A GOB LED display achieves this with remarkable precision. Typical pixel pitches for showroom applications range from P1.2 mm to P2.5 mm. For a high-end luxury showroom where customers examine vehicles from as close as 1.5 meters, a P1.5 mm or P1.8 mm pitch is recommended. This ultra-fine pixel density ensures that text, logos, and high-resolution video of the vehicle appear razor-sharp with no visible pixelation. The display’s brightness is another critical factor. In a brightly lit showroom with ambient light levels exceeding 500 lux, the display must deliver between 800 and 1500 nits to maintain contrast and color saturation. GOB technology enhances this performance by reducing surface glare and improving the black level. The optical glue layer minimizes internal light refraction, allowing for deeper blacks and a contrast ratio that can exceed 5000:1. This results in a vibrant, true-to-life image where the metallic flake in a paint job or the gloss of a polished rim is rendered with photographic realism. Furthermore, the refresh rate of 3840 Hz or higher eliminates any flicker, even when captured on camera for promotional videos or live streaming events.
A car showroom is not a controlled server room; it is a dynamic space where displays are exposed to physical contact. Standard indoor LED panels are vulnerable to damage from a misplaced elbow, a cleaning cloth, or the vibration from a nearby door closing. The GOB LED display solves this vulnerability through its protective encapsulation. The glue coating, typically a high-grade silicone or epoxy, creates a seamless, impact-absorbing surface over the LED chips and the PCB board. This layer provides an IP rating of IP65 on the front of the panel, making it fully dust-tight and protected against low-pressure water jets. In practical terms, this means the display can be safely wiped down with a damp cloth to remove fingerprints or dust without risking short circuits or component damage. The impact resistance is equally important; the GOB surface can withstand a force of up to 50 N without damaging the individual LEDs. For a car showroom, this translates to a lower total cost of ownership. There is no need for a bulky protective glass or acrylic shield, which can cause glare and reduce image quality. The display remains flush, sleek, and inherently robust, capable of enduring the daily activity of a busy retail environment for years without dead pixels or image degradation.
Car showrooms are designed for exploration. Customers do not view a display from a single, fixed point; they walk around the vehicle, approach from the side, and view content from various distances and angles. A GOB LED display excels in this scenario. The optical glue layer not only protects the LEDs but also diffuses the light output, creating a wider and more uniform viewing cone. Typical horizontal and vertical viewing angles exceed 160 degrees, ensuring that colors and brightness remain consistent whether a person is standing directly in front of the screen or at an extreme 80-degree angle. This is a significant advantage over traditional LCD video walls, which suffer from color shift and contrast loss when viewed off-axis. The uniformity of the GOB surface also eliminates the “screen door” effect common in older LED displays, where the dark spaces between LEDs are visible. Because the glue fills these gaps, the display presents a smooth, continuous image that appears more like a single, giant screen than a collection of individual modules. This seamless appearance is crucial for creating a premium, high-end aesthetic that aligns with the brand image of luxury automotive manufacturers. The result is a display that engages customers from every point in the showroom, ensuring that promotional content, vehicle specifications, and lifestyle videos are always perfectly visible.
Operating a large-scale video wall in a showroom 12 to 16 hours a day generates significant heat and electricity costs. The GOB LED display offers tangible advantages in both power consumption and thermal management. The encapsulation material acts as an effective heat conductor, drawing thermal energy away from the sensitive LED chips and distributing it across the panel surface. This passive cooling effect reduces the reliance on internal fans, leading to quieter operation—a critical benefit in a quiet, sophisticated showroom environment where fan noise can be a distraction. In terms of power draw, a well-designed GOB panel typically consumes between 100 and 180 watts per square meter at maximum brightness, with an average consumption of 40 to 70 watts per square meter for typical content. For a 3-meter by 2-meter video wall (6 square meters), this means an average power consumption of roughly 240 to 420 watts. This is significantly lower than a comparable LCD video wall of the same size and brightness. Furthermore, the reduced heat output lowers the load on the showroom’s HVAC system, contributing to further energy savings. When combined with a low-voltage DC power supply, the system becomes not only efficient but also safer, reducing the risk of electrical hazards in a public space. For a car showroom aiming for LEED certification or simply seeking to lower operational expenses, the GOB LED display represents a financially and environmentally sound investment.
The physical design of a GOB LED display is tailored for architectural integration. Panels are ultra-thin, often less than 30 mm in depth, allowing them to be flush-mounted against a wall or even curved to create an immersive, wrap-around environment. The front-serviceable design of most GOB panels means that maintenance can be performed entirely from the front of the display, allowing the wall to be installed directly against a showroom wall without the need for rear access space. This maximizes valuable floor space. The display’s resolution is modular, meaning it can be scaled to any size or aspect ratio. A showroom might use a 16:9 landscape format for standard video content or a 1:1 square format for a unique, artistic presentation of a vehicle. The system supports multiple video inputs, including HDMI, DisplayPort, and SDI, allowing it to be driven by a media player, a laptop, or a centralized control system. Content versatility is a major selling point. The same display can show a high-resolution 4K video of a car driving along a coastal highway, a detailed spec sheet with pricing, or a live feed from a showroom camera. With a processing system that supports multi-window layouts, the screen can be divided into zones for different types of content simultaneously. This flexibility allows dealerships to tailor the message to each customer, showing a specific vehicle configuration or a promotional offer based on the time of day or the customer’s interest. The GOB LED display becomes the central nervous system of the showroom’s visual communication, capable of adapting to any marketing need.

COB (Chip-on-Board) LED technology represents the next generation of display manufacturing. By directly mounting LED chips onto the PCB substrate, COB displays achieve higher pixel density, better contrast ratios, and superior protection against dust and moisture compared to traditional SMD technology.
